Types of support available
In Island Park, survivors can access a range of support services:
- Lawyers: Legal professionals experienced in domestic violence cases can help you understand your rights and navigate the legal system.
- Therapists: Mental health professionals can provide counseling and emotional support tailored to your experiences.
- Shelters: Temporary housing options are available for those needing a safe place away from their situation.
- Hotlines: Confidential hotlines offer immediate support and guidance from trained advocates.
- Legal Aid: Organizations providing free or low-cost legal assistance for those who qualify.
Legal protections overview
Survivors in Island Park have access to various legal protections. These may include restraining orders, custody arrangements, and protections in housing. Itβs essential to consult with a local lawyer to understand the specific protections available in your jurisdiction.
Safety planning basics
Creating a safety plan is crucial for anyone in an unsafe situation. Consider the following steps:
- Identify safe spaces in your home or community.
- Keep important documents accessible and secure.
- Establish a code word with trusted friends or family for emergencies.
- Plan how to leave safely and where to go.
- Have a bag packed with essentials if you need to leave quickly.
